I’ve had this place on my list ever since watching Terrace House Aloha State. We ended up not having enough time a few years ago, so I made a brunch reservation for our first morning this past trip. Very glad I prioritized this restaurant finally. Gerny and his colleagues were awesome and attentive, even though we were kind of off on the edge. We had brunch on the patio. It was a bit warm for Hawaii, but the shade and the ocean breeze made it pleasant. There were lots of boats, surfers, and even turtles popping up for some air every few minutes. We aren’t drinkers, so can only speak to the mocktails, and the Sunset Cooler was phenomenal. We also started off with the fruit bowl appetizer. I, unfortunately, still hate papaya, but my partner loved it. I enjoyed every other piece of fruit in there - all incredibly fresh tasting. I had an odd craving for spaghetti and my partner ordered from the brunch menu, and we both polished our plates off as well as we could. We were stuffed, but were having such a good time we decided we had to at least try to eat dessert. We ordered a Diamond Head Canele Set to share. My favorite was the matcha, but they were all amazing. We finally ordered a pastry basket to go, and had that for breakfast the next morning. Even a day old, they were some of the best pastries we had in a very long time. If we ever make it back to Oahu, we will definitely be prioritizing another meal here.

Luxurious fine dining restaurant with seaside Vista and gorgeous view of honolulu. Right by Kewalo harbor entrance and you can watch boats transiting the channel. Great view of the Aloha Friday fireworks too if you dine in on a Friday evening. Staff are extremely courteous and friendly. Great fine dining experience.
